How is the Jeep Recon Powered?

As we mentioned above, the Jeep Recon is an all-electric vehicle, more commonly known as a battery-electric vehicle or BEV. This means that the Recon does away with an internal combustion engine completely and uses just a pair of electric motors and a rechargeable EV battery pack. Not only does this save drivers on fuel costs and emissions, it also saves them on maintenance and provides exciting performance. The Recon’s performance comes from high levels of power and immediate torque distribution. Whereas internal combustion engines require time between when you press the gas pedal and when all of the engine’s torque meets the wheels for the air/fuel mixture to ignite, the electric power from a BEV is instantly available, giving you 100% of the torque from a standstill. This makes merging on the highway a breeze, but it also enhances the off-road capability as it allows you to overcome trail obstacles without having to build up RPMs. The Recon is also equipped with other standard off-roading equipment, including but not limited to Selec-Terrain traction management and locking front and rear differentials. To boast about the Recon’s range and capability, Jeep stated that on a full charge, it has the ability to surpass the fearsome Rubicon Trail here in California with enough remaining battery power to make it back to town and recharge. 

Design of the Jeep Recon

The Recon might be a vehicle straight from the future, but it is still authentically Jeep. By wearing the instantly recognizable seven-slot grille, a high and wide commanding road presence, grille ring LED lighting, and rugged lower cladding, the Jeep Recon is the perfect balance between vintage Jeep and future Jeep. Another feature that gives it that vintage Jeep touch is the open-air freedom it provides with removable doors and windows in addition to the Sky One-Touch power sliding top. To enhance the Recon’s off-roading abilities, Jeep gave it aggressive all-terrain tires, underbody skid plate protection, and electric blue tow hooks. 

Jeep's Electric Present and Future

Jeep’s path toward its goal of Zero Emissions Freedom started in 2021 with the release of the Wrangler 4xe lineup. Now also available for the Grand Cherokee, the 4xe powertrain links a 2.0L turbocharged I-4 engine to two EV motors and a rechargeable battery pack, making it Jeep’s first-ever plug-in hybrid electric vehicle powertrain. This setup gives both models 375 horsepower and 470 lb-ft of torque, while the Wrangler maintains the gas equivalent of 49 MPG, and the Grand Cherokee gets 56. Jeep has plans to spread the 4xe powertrain to the entire Jeep lineup by the 2025 model year. Additionally, Jeep has laid plans to become a leader in the electric SUV market by making 50% of all sales battery-electric vehicles by the 2030 model year. As for the Jeep Recon, ordering is set to open at the beginning of 2023, with production beginning in 2024.
